Water supply in 58 areas in Klang, Shah Alam fully restored — Air Selangor

By Selangor Journal Team

SHAH ALAM, Dec 30 — The water supply in all 58 areas in Klang and Shah Alam that were affected by an unscheduled water cut has been fully restored earlier than expected at 9am today.

Pengurusan Air Selangor Sdn Bhd (Air Selangor) had earlier today said that the water supply in the remaining nine areas was expected to recover by 12 noon.

“Air Selangor would like to thank all users for their patience and cooperation during the unscheduled water cut.

“We urge the cooperation from the public to report of any pipe burst or leak incident in Selangor, Kuala Lumpur and Putrajaya to ensure that repair works can be conducted immediately,” it said in a statement today.

Yesterday, the water supply in two Selangor districts, which include 72 areas in Petaling, was cut at 1pm following a burst pipe incident at Bulatan Persiaran Tengku Ampuan in Section 15, here.

The repair works on the burst pipe had completed as per schedule at 9pm last night and the distribution of the water supply was channelled beginning at 9.30pm.
